i am currently a first year nursing student and planning to continue to dentistry...is this bad? i just like to have something to support me if it all doesnt work out...i am willing to spend the 1-2 yrs finishing doctoral level science courses. thanks.

its not bad if that what you eventually want to do. however, you should consider that in order for you to apply to dental school, you'll need to fulfill the general science requirements and take the DAT in order to apply. That will take 2-3 years in length..
